Lady Gaga’s Valentine’s Day Little Monster stunt celebrates the launch of ‘Born this way’ single
Universal Music and Sydney-based agency Rockstar Management have executed a stunt simultaneously this morning in Sydney and Melbourne, to celebrate the single launch of Lady Gaga’s ‘Born This Way’ from the yet to be released album of the same name.
A gaggle of Gaga-look-a-likes have paraded at several radio and TV media outlets this morning. The ‘Aussie Little Monsters’ sent love back to Gaga via an impromptu radio interview at 2Day FM with Danno, and a Grant Denyer and Sunrise strut-by in Martin Place.
The reigning queen of pop music tweeted last week, “Can’t wait any longer, single coming Friday,” (twitter.com/ladygaga). ‘Born This Way’ is her latest offering, and in line with Gaga’s philosophy, Rockstar recruited a mix of leggy models and drag queens dressed as the style icon to hit the pavement armed with their best Gaga-moves.
